#001f95 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#001f95 is composed of 0% red, 12.2% green and 58.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 100% cyan, 79.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 41.6% black. It has a hue angle of 227.5 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 29.2%. #001f95 color hex could be obtained by blending #003eff with #00002b. Closest websafe color is: #003399.

Shades and Tints of #001f95
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#00020c is the darkest color, while #f7f9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#001f95
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#454750 is the less saturated color, while #001f95 is the most saturated one.
